Ignite Charity: Waterloo – September 12th

Congratulations to Ignite Charity: Waterloo on their premiere event September 12th! What is Ignite Charity: Waterloo? This first of its kind event follows that same format as the other Ignite Events you have come to know and love, but with a twist: the thought-provoking topics are about all-things charity! This is a fabulous opportunity to spark conversation and collaboration throughout the community. The first event will be held in Waterloo on September 12th. After that, watch for events to pop up in other cities!

While we at Ignite Waterloo strongly support the efforts of Ignite Charity: Waterloo, we would like to ensure there is an understanding that their efforts are completely independent of those of Ignite Waterloo. We are proud to have been an inspiration to Ignite Charity Waterloo and wish them great success in spreading the word and opening the minds about local charitable efforts.

Ignite Waterloo 10 on October 23 at CIGI

We’ve been hard at work making plans for our next big event. Today we’re excited to announce that Ignite Waterloo 10 will be held on Tuesday, October 23 at the Centre for International Governance Innovation in Waterloo.

Those of you who have followed us for a while will know that we love to hold our events in interesting spaces in Waterloo Region. Our roster of past event venues makes for an impressive list:

  • The Museum (3 times!)
  • Conrad Centre for the Performing Arts
  • The Tannery (2 times!)
  • Whistle Bear Golf Club
  • Waterloo Region Museum
  • Perimeter Institute

These sites have helped make for nine successful evenings of presentations, socializing, and fun. That tradition will continue at our tenth event the Centre for International Governance Innovation. Normally home to research, policy debate and discussion on multilateral governance improvements, on October 23, 2012, CIGI will also be a temporary home to the traveling Ignite Waterloo community.
